The Importance of Social Security For Coconut Sugar Farmers

The coconut sugar farmer is high-risk profession. They have to climb coconut trees every day to extract nectar/sap,the raw material for coconut sugar.

They have to climb the trees twice in a day, in the morning and evening. The average height of fruiting coconut trees in Banyumas Regency ranges from 5 to 12 meters.

Climbing these trees makes many farmers worry for their safety.

They must accept the risk of falling from the coconut tree when tapping the coconut nectar.

Furthermore, there are risks of injury, permanent disability, and even death which is always a concern for coconut sugar farmers.

From 2018, Inagro Jinawi started to lodge its registered coconut sugar farmers to join Indonesia’s National Social Security Agency for Employment (BPJS Ketenagakerjaan).

We recognize that we must consider the safety and welfare of our registered farmers.

Inagro Jinawi has registered 1,509 out of 1,807 registered farmers, per October 2022, to Indonesia’s National Social Security Agency for Employment.  This number will continue to increase shortly. The setting down process is carried out collectively by Inagro Jinawi.

Moreover, the monthly payment of Indonesia’s National Social Security Agency for Employment is 100% covered by Inagro Jinawi. Indeed, relieved our registered farmers.
